Subject: [PATCH] sched: dynamic config sd_flags if described in DT

From: Wang Qing <wangqing@...o.com>

The device tree can describe cache topology by "next-level-cache",
Prefer configuring SD_SHARE_PKG_RESOURCES from DT instead of default value.

Signed-off-by: Wang Qing <wangqing@...o.com>
---
 arch/arm/kernel/smp.c         |  1 +
 arch/arm64/kernel/smp.c       |  1 +
 arch/riscv/kernel/smpboot.c   |  1 +
 drivers/base/arch_topology.c  | 59 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 include/linux/arch_topology.h |  2 ++
 kernel/sched/topology.c       | 10 ++++++++
 6 files changed, 74 insertions(+)

diff --git a/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c b/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c
index 73fc645..62bbd9a
--- a/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c
+++ b/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c
@@ -508,6 +508,7 @@ void __init smp_prepare_cpus(unsigned int max_cpus)
 	unsigned int ncores = num_possible_cpus();
 
 	init_cpu_topology();
+	init_cpu_cache_topology();
 
 	smp_store_cpu_info(smp_processor_id());
 
diff --git a/arch/arm64/kernel/smp.c b/arch/arm64/kernel/smp.c
index 27df5c1..94cf649
--- a/arch/arm64/kernel/smp.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kernel/smp.c
@@ -723,6 +723,7 @@ void __init smp_prepare_cpus(unsigned int max_cpus)
 	unsigned int this_cpu;
 
 	init_cpu_topology();
+	init_cpu_cache_topology();
 
 	this_cpu = smp_processor_id();
 	store_cpu_topology(this_cpu);
diff --git a/arch/riscv/kernel/smpboot.c b/arch/riscv/kernel/smpboot.c
index 622f226..4f5a8b7
--- a/arch/riscv/kernel/smpboot.c
+++ b/arch/riscv/kernel/smpboot.c
@@ -41,6 +41,7 @@ static DECLARE_COMPLETION(cpu_running);
 void __init smp_prepare_boot_cpu(void)
 {
 	init_cpu_topology();
+	init_cpu_cache_topology();
 #ifdef CONFIG_RISCV_ERRATA_ALTERNATIVE
 	apply_boot_alternatives();
 #endif
diff --git a/drivers/base/arch_topology.c b/drivers/base/arch_topology.c
index 9761541..127f540
--- a/drivers/base/arch_topology.c
+++ b/drivers/base/arch_topology.c
@@ -609,6 +609,65 @@ static int __init parse_dt_topology(void)
 #endif
 
 /*
+ * cpu cache topology table
+ */
+#define MAX_CACHE_LEVEL 7
+struct device_node *cache_topology[NR_CPUS][MAX_CACHE_LEVEL];
+
+void init_cpu_cache_topology(void)
+{
+	struct device_node *node_cpu, *node_cache;
+	int cpu, level;
+
+	for_each_possible_cpu(cpu) {
+		node_cpu = of_get_cpu_node(cpu, NULL);
+		if (!node_cpu)
+			continue;
+
+		level = 0;
+		node_cache = node_cpu;
+		while (level < MAX_CACHE_LEVEL) {
+			node_cache = of_parse_phandle(node_cache, "next-level-cache", 0);
+			if (!node_cache)
+				break;
+
+			cache_topology[cpu][level++] = node_cache;
+		}
+		of_node_put(node_cpu);
+	}
+}
+
+int cpus_share_self_cache(const struct cpumask *cpu_map)
+{
+	int cache_level, cpu_id;
+	int first, last;
+	int id = cpumask_first(cpu_map);
+	int size = cpumask_weight(cpu_map);
+
+	for (cache_level = 0; cache_level < MAX_CACHE_LEVEL; cache_level++) {
+		if (!cache_topology[cpu][cache_level])
+			return -1;
+
+		first = -1;
+		last = id;
+		for (cpu_id = 0; cpu_id < NR_CPUS; cpu_id++) {
+			if (cache_topology[cpu][cache_level] == cache_topology[cpu_id][cache_level]) {
+				if (cpu_id < id || cpu_id >= id + size)
+					return 0;
+
+				first = (first == -1)?cpu_id:first;
+				last = cpu_id;
+			}
+		}
+
+		if (first == id && last == id + size)
+			return 1;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/*
  * cpu topology table
  */
 struct cpu_topology cpu_topology[NR_CPUS];
diff --git a/include/linux/arch_topology.h b/include/linux/arch_topology.h
index cce6136b..862e584
--- a/include/linux/arch_topology.h
+++ b/include/linux/arch_topology.h
@@ -82,6 +82,8 @@ extern struct cpu_topology cpu_topology[NR_CPUS];
 #define topology_cluster_cpumask(cpu)	(&cpu_topology[cpu].cluster_sibling)
 #define topology_llc_cpumask(cpu)	(&cpu_topology[cpu].llc_sibling)
 void init_cpu_topology(void);
+void init_cpu_cache_topology(void);
+int cpus_share_self_cache(const struct cpumask *cpu_map);
 void store_cpu_topology(unsigned int cpuid);
 const struct cpumask *cpu_coregroup_mask(int cpu);
 const struct cpumask *cpu_clustergroup_mask(int cpu);
diff --git a/kernel/sched/topology.c b/kernel/sched/topology.c
index d201a70..8264e2d
--- a/kernel/sched/topology.c
+++ b/kernel/sched/topology.c
@@ -1527,6 +1527,7 @@ sd_init(struct sched_domain_topology_level *tl,
 	struct sched_domain *sd = *per_cpu_ptr(sdd->sd, cpu);
 	int sd_id, sd_weight, sd_flags = 0;
 	struct cpumask *sd_span;
+	int ret;
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_NUMA
 	/*
@@ -1539,6 +1540,15 @@ sd_init(struct sched_domain_topology_level *tl,
 
 	if (tl->sd_flags)
 		sd_flags = (*tl->sd_flags)();
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_GENERIC_ARCH_TOPOLOGY
+	ret = cpus_share_self_cache(cpu_map);
+	if (ret == 1)
+		sd_flags |= SD_SHARE_PKG_RESOURCES;
+	else if (ret == 0)
+		sd_flags &= ~SD_SHARE_PKG_RESOURCES;
+#endif
+
 	if (WARN_ONCE(sd_flags & ~TOPOLOGY_SD_FLAGS,
 			"wrong sd_flags in topology description\n"))
 		sd_flags &= TOPOLOGY_SD_FLAGS;
